Network Technical Staff-Juniper
Description
This is a developing technical contributor role for an engineer with solid Juniper routing and switching experience who is ready to build their career in a technically rigorous environment. You have around 4 years of relevant experience, a CCNP-level foundation, and real hands-on time with Juniper platforms. You’ll work alongside experienced engineers on complex enterprise infrastructure, sharpen your skills on live engagements, and grow in an environment that takes quality seriously.
Work Location
This position supports a program based in the Woodlawn, MD area.
Please note that this is a full-time, direct-hire role. Due to segments of our customer base, we cannot sponsor employment visas. It is required that you have the ability to obtain and maintain a public trust.
Responsibilities
- Contribute to technical projects as a developing team member, working under the guidance of senior engineers
- Support Juniper routing and switching tasks including configuration, maintenance, and troubleshooting
- Assist in producing technical documentation with review and feedback from senior team members
- Raise issues that could impact a project to the appropriate senior engineer or leadership
Position Requirements
- Around 4 years of hands-on experience in enterprise networking
- Active CCNP certification or equivalent; Juniper certifications such as JNCIS-ENT are equally welcome
- Demonstrated hands-on experience with Juniper routing and switching platforms — configuration, troubleshooting, and day-to-day operations
- Solid understanding of enterprise routing and switching protocols including BGP, OSPF, and standard Layer 2/Layer 3 fundamentals
- Works well with regular oversight; takes direction, applies it consistently, and is building toward greater independence
- Able to contribute to detailed technical documents with guidance and editorial review
- Understands the importance of keeping project and forecast information accurate and follows company policies consistently
